Core Viewpoint - The collaboration between Beijing and Inner Mongolia is enhancing logistics, agricultural product sales, and local employment, showcasing a successful model of mutual benefit and development [1][9]. Group 1: Logistics and Agricultural Products - The "Beijing Shunyi Logistics Transfer Warehouse" in Zhaoquanying Town has become a crucial hub connecting high-quality agricultural products from Inner Mongolia to the Beijing market, reducing delivery costs by 35% [1]. - By 2025, the logistics center will feature 20 categories and 380 products, with over 30 enterprises participating and partnerships with major platforms like JD.com and Taobao [3]. Group 2: Technological Advancements in Agriculture - The introduction of enzyme fermentation feed technology is transforming traditional livestock farming, improving feed conversion rates and reducing costs by approximately 1,200 yuan per cow annually [7]. - This technology is being applied to 12,846 cattle across multiple towns and villages, enhancing immunity and meat quality, thus supporting rural revitalization [7]. Group 3: Employment and Economic Development - In 2025, Shunyi District allocated 149 million yuan for 33 assistance projects, resulting in 7.3 billion yuan in sales of Inner Mongolian agricultural products and creating over 6,000 local jobs [1][9]. - The collaboration has led to significant investments, with 8,760 million yuan brought in by teams working in Ba Lin Zuoqi, creating local employment opportunities [9]. Group 4: Cultural and Educational Exchange - Educational initiatives include sending 43 teachers from Shunyi to Inner Mongolia and receiving 73 local educators for training, fostering strong emotional connections between teachers and students [13]. - Cultural promotion activities have increased tourism and consumption in key scenic areas, with a 15% rise in visitor numbers and nearly one million yuan in increased cultural spending [11]. Group 5: Healthcare Collaboration - The healthcare partnership involves sending 34 medical professionals to Inner Mongolia and receiving 48 local staff for training, improving medical services and filling gaps in various specialties [15]. - The collaboration has led to the standardization of treatment processes and the introduction of new medical technologies in local hospitals [15].

Core Insights - Qinghai Province's total import and export value reached 6.45 billion yuan in the first 11 months of the year, marking a 30.1% increase compared to the same period last year, maintaining the highest growth rate in the country [1] - The number of enterprises engaged in import and export activities in Qinghai increased to 225, a net increase of 20 companies, representing a growth of 9.8% [1] - Private enterprises accounted for 88.7% of the province's total foreign trade value, with an import and export value of 5.72 billion yuan, growing by 48% [1] Import and Export Performance - Exports of lithium-ion batteries reached 2.76 billion yuan, growing 4.9 times, and contributed 46.2 percentage points to the province's overall import and export growth [2] - The export of agricultural products reached 670 million yuan, a 21.6% increase, with frozen trout exports leading the nation at 340 million yuan, accounting for 98.3% of the national total for similar products [2] - The import of agricultural products grew by 50.9%, making it the largest category of imports for the province, with a total value of 420 million yuan [2] Trade Relationships - Qinghai maintained trade relations with 119 countries and regions, adding 21 new trading partners compared to the previous year [1] - Trade with countries involved in the Belt and Road Initiative reached 5.36 billion yuan, a 47.3% increase, accounting for 83.2% of the province's total import and export value [1] - Major trading partners among Belt and Road countries included Hungary, Vietnam, and Russia, with respective trade values of 2.71 billion yuan, 490 million yuan, and 430 million yuan, showing significant growth rates [1]

Core Viewpoint - The proposal by the Qinghai Provincial Committee emphasizes the high-quality construction of industrial clusters, aiming to enhance the development capabilities of the "Four Lands" industry and establish a world-class modern salt lake industry system [1] Group 1: Industrial Development - The plan includes the efficient utilization of potassium salts, quality enhancement of lithium salts, and innovative breakthroughs in magnesium salts, alongside the extraction and utilization of rare elements [1] - Aiming to develop a trillion-level industrial cluster around salt lake resources, the initiative seeks to strengthen the "Salt Lake+" industry [1] Group 2: Clean Energy Initiatives - The proposal outlines the construction of a large-scale wind and solar energy base in the "Shagohuang" area, promoting the application of solar thermal power technology [1] - The goal is to accelerate the growth of a trillion-level new energy industrial cluster and establish a national clean energy industry hub [1] Group 3: Ecotourism Development - The plan includes the establishment of international ecotourism destination demonstration zones, focusing on areas such as the Qinghai Lake and the Yellow River [1] - The initiative aims to enhance high-quality ecotourism products and services, positioning ecotourism as a pillar industry for the province [1] Group 4: Agricultural and Livestock Products - The strategy emphasizes improving storage, preservation, and cold chain logistics facilities to enhance the output of specialty agricultural and livestock products like beef, lamb, and cool-season vegetables [1] - There is a focus on expanding international markets and establishing a well-known green organic agricultural and livestock product export hub [1] Group 5: Policy and Talent Integration - The proposal encourages the effective aggregation of policies, talent, and platforms to promote integrated development trials and demonstrations [1] - The aim is to foster mutual promotion and integration among the "Four Lands" industries [1]

Core Viewpoint - The opening of the Huazhong Shared Pre-warehouse in Zhengzhou marks a significant step for Inner Mongolia's high-quality agricultural and livestock products to enter the central China market, providing a new support point for "Meng" branded products [1] Group 1: Warehouse and Logistics - The pre-warehouse is located in the core area of Zhengzhou's national logistics hub, surrounded by major highways, enabling rapid distribution to the Central Plains urban agglomeration and forming an efficient "cold chain delivery circle" [1] - The operational model combines "government guidance + market operation," allowing resident companies to benefit from centralized warehousing and intelligent management services, which reduce overall logistics costs and improve delivery efficiency [1] - Logistics time to major cities in Central China is expected to be shortened by more than one day, with "next-day delivery" covering over 50 core cities [1] Group 2: Infrastructure and Technology - The warehouse is built to high standards, equipped with multi-temperature storage, intelligent sorting, and full-temperature control systems, catering to the storage and distribution needs of various Inner Mongolian agricultural and livestock products [1] - An intelligent management system enables traceability and control throughout the entire process from storage to delivery, providing stable and reliable logistics support for "Meng" branded products [1] Group 3: Market Impact - Inner Mongolian agricultural and livestock product companies can achieve lower logistics costs and faster market response capabilities through the pre-warehouse, significantly enhancing their competitiveness in the Central China market [1] - Consumers in Central China will have easier access to and more favorable prices for fresh products from the grasslands [1]

Core Insights - The Inner Mongolia Specialty Agricultural Products Promotion Event took place in Guangzhou, showcasing a variety of high-quality agricultural and livestock products from Inner Mongolia, attracting significant interest from local residents and tourists [1][3] Group 1: Agricultural Production - Inner Mongolia ranks first in China for the production of beef, lamb, and milk, with key industry chains generating over 700 billion yuan in value [3] - The region exports over 500 billion jin of grain annually, along with more than 8 million tons of milk and 1.8 million tons of beef and lamb [3] Group 2: Market Engagement - The "Grassland Market" attracted over 200,000 visitors in the Beijing Road business district on the day of the event [4] - Local consumers showed strong interest in products such as natural sheep milk powder, with significant sales reported at various stalls [3][4] Group 3: Strategic Collaborations - The event was supported by multiple cities in Inner Mongolia and aimed to enhance agricultural cooperation between Guangdong and Inner Mongolia [4] - Partnerships were formed between Bay Area enterprises and Inner Mongolian agricultural companies to streamline the distribution of products from Inner Mongolia to the Bay Area [4]

Core Insights - Hohhot City is focusing on "ecological priority and green development" to transform and upgrade its agriculture and animal husbandry sectors through brand building, establishing a "1+9+N" regional public brand system with a total assessed value of 73.231 billion yuan [1] - The brand operation mechanism has been upgraded, with the management rights of the "Hohhot Prairie" public brand and nine sub-brands officially transferred to the Hohhot Agricultural Reclamation Group, aiming for centralized resource integration [1] - The city is addressing the challenges of small, scattered, and weak brands by promoting technological innovation and enhancing the industrial chain, including the construction of high-standard farmland and cold chain logistics [2] Brand Development - The "Hohhot Prairie" public brand serves as the core of the regional brand system, which includes nine sub-brands such as grassland lamb, beef, and milk, contributing to the high-quality development of the region [1] - A total of 20 enterprises have received the "Meng" brand certification, and over 60 enterprises have obtained brand authorization, covering various product categories [1] Technological and Logistical Innovations - The city is implementing high-standard farmland construction and efficient water-saving irrigation projects, collaborating with institutions like the Chinese Academy of Sciences to innovate agricultural techniques [2] - A cold chain logistics route has been established in partnership with SF Express, enabling rapid delivery of brand products to major cities across the country [2]

Core Insights - The meeting held on November 5 in Xining focused on the construction of Qinghai as a green organic agricultural and livestock product output area, highlighting significant achievements since the initiative began in 2021 [1][3] - Qinghai has established itself as the largest production base for organic livestock products, organic goji berries, and cold-water fish in China, with a notable increase in export capabilities and brand influence [1][3] Summary by Categories Achievements - Since the launch of the output area construction, Qinghai has built the largest organic livestock product, organic goji berry, and cold-water fish production bases in the country [1] - The province has also developed national-level spring rapeseed and potato seed production bases, achieving historic breakthroughs in the export of specialty agricultural products [1][3] Economic Impact - During the 14th Five-Year Plan period, Qinghai's green organic agricultural and livestock products reached a total of 1,621, with cumulative output exceeding 3.248 million tons, generating a value of 55.91 billion yuan [3] - The rapid transformation and upgrading of specialty industries have provided strong momentum for the modernization of agriculture and rural revitalization in Qinghai [3] Government Support - The Ministry of Agriculture and Rural Affairs has supported Qinghai's green organic industry development through fee reductions, totaling 21.86 million yuan over five years [3] - Future support will focus on accelerating the development of agricultural product quality standards, encouraging green organic certification, and enhancing agricultural technology platforms [3]
